python计算无向图节点度的实例代码
时间:2020-10-03 10:13:42|栏目:Python代码|点击: 次
废话不多说了,直接上代码吧:
#Copyright (c)2017, 东北大学软件学院学生 # All rightsreserved #文件名称:a.py # 作 者:孔云 #问题描述:统计图中的每个节点的度,并生成度序列 #问题分析:利用networkx。代码如下: import networkx as nx G=nx.random_graphs.barabasi_albert_graph(1000,3)#生成n=1000,m=3的无标度的图 print ("某个节点的度:",G.degree(0))#返回某个节点的度 print("所有节点的度:",G.degree())#返回所有节点的度 print("所有节点的度分布序列:",nx.degree_histogram(G))#返回图中所有节点的度分布序列(从1至最大度的出现次数)
运行结果:
注:运行结果有点多,运行结果截图不全。
上一篇:python调用百度语音识别实现大音频文件语音识别功能
栏 目:Python代码
本文标题:python计算无向图节点度的实例代码
本文地址:http://www.codeinn.net/misctech/6210.html